Pavillion REIT to acquire da:mén USJ shopping mall for RM488mil QUOTE Pavilion REIT said the proposed acquisition will be funded by debt facilities which will increase its gearing ratio from 15% as at June 30, 2015 to 23% — below the gearing limit of 50% prescribed by the REIT guidelines.
The acquisition is expected to be completed by the first quarter of financial year 2016. http://www.theedgemarkets.com/my/article/p...?type=Corporate
